5 Facts About Jan Garbarek’s Visible World
Recorded in June 1995 The album was recorded in June 1995 at Rainbow Studio in Oslo, Norway.
A studio known for its acoustics Rainbow Studio is famous for its exceptional acoustics, which suited Garbarek’s atmospheric style.
Features Garbarek’s signature sound The album showcases his distinctive soprano and tenor saxophone playing, blending jazz with Nordic folk influences.
Includes a diverse ensemble Garbarek is joined by musicians on keyboards, bass, drums, and percussion, creating a rich, layered texture.
A concept album about landscapes Visible World is inspired by natural and urban landscapes, with each track evoking a specific place or mood.
